黄色网址大全免费-黄色网址你懂得-黄色网址你懂的-黄色网址有那些-免费超爽视频-免费大片黄国产在线观看

專注Java教育14年 全國咨詢/投訴熱線:400-8080-105
動力節點LOGO圖
始于2009,口口相傳的Java黃埔軍校
首頁 學習攻略 Java學習 Java字符串排序算法的規則

Java字符串排序算法的規則

更新時間:2022-12-23 10:53:32 來源:動力節點 瀏覽2165次

Java字符串排序算法的規則是什么?動力節點小編來告訴大家。

排序規則:按長度排序,長度相同按字符串排序

解決思路: 使用TreeSet 存字符串 并使用Compareator比較器指定比較規則

public static void main(String[] args) {
        //創建集合,并指定比較規則
        TreeSet<String> treeSet =  new TreeSet<String>(new Comparator<String>() {
            @Override
            public int compare(String o1, String o2) {
                int n1 = o1.length() - o2.length();
                int n2 =  o1.compareTo(o2);
                return n1==0? n2:n1;
            }
        });
        treeSet.add("zhangsan");
        treeSet.add("lisi");
        treeSet.add("zhaoliyin");
        treeSet.add("liuyifei");
        treeSet.add("lyangmi");
        for (String s : treeSet) {
            System.out.println(s + ":" + s.length());
        }

運行結果

lisi:4
lyangmi:7
liuyifei:8
zhangsan:8
zhaoliyin:9

 

提交申請后,顧問老師會電話與您溝通安排學習

免費課程推薦 >>
技術文檔推薦 >>
主站蜘蛛池模板: 成人xxx免费视频播放 | 国产亚洲午夜精品 | 欧美xxxxxxxxxx黑人 | 波多野结衣在线观看一区二区 | 日韩国产中文字幕 | 18成人免费观看视频 | 日韩精品免费一区二区三区 | 日韩欧美视频在线播放 | 午夜寂寞网 | 狠狠操亚洲 | 亚洲免费大片 | 999热成人精品国产免 | 国产二三区| 天天干视频在线观看 | 麻豆一区区三三四区产品麻豆 | 91黄色软件 | 羞羞视频观看 | 日本videos高清hd | 波多野结衣一区免费作品 | 亚洲不卡影院 | 青草午夜精品视频在线观看 | 视频免费1区二区三区 | 精品400部自拍视频在线播放 | 国产精品亚洲国产三区 | 国产特级全黄一级毛片不卡 | 波多野结衣资源在线观看 | 国产成人一级片 | 欧美精品videossex变态 | www.九色视频| 宅男噜噜噜一区二区三区 | 日日夜夜摸 | www视频在线免费观看 | 国产大片免费观看中文字幕 | 先锋影音在线资源669 | 国产乱人伦偷精品视频不卡 | 亚洲 欧美 日韩在线综合福利 | 天天干天天操天天做 | 欧美视频二区 | 天天碰天天干 | 久久天天躁狠狠躁夜夜中文字幕 | 免费日批 |